Answer: The lorry is traveling 10 mph over the expected speed.
Step-by-step explanation:
If 200 miles takes 4 hours, the speed is 200mi/4hr which is 50 mph.
If the distance is increased by 20%, the distance is 240 miles.
240mi/4hr = 60mph
The difference is 10mph

Simplify square roots
find all the prime factors of the radicand
and group them in pairs
any factor that appears in a pair can be pulled out in front of the radical sign once for ever group of two that can be made.
